Best Minnesota Private Preschools Offering Basketball Sport (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 138 private preschools offering basketball as an interscholastic sport serving 41,140 students in Minnesota.
The top ranked offering basketball sport private preschools in Minnesota include The Blake School (Middle School, grades 6-8), The Blake School Early Learning Center, and The Blake School/Upper School.
The average tuition cost is $7,691, which is lower than the Minnesota private preschool average tuition cost of $8,903.
94% of private preschools offering basketball sport in Minnesota are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ic and Lutheran Church Missouri Synod).
